Cockermouth Ukuleles will be debuting their tribute to the Times & Star at Cockermouth Alive Again! on Saturday.
The event, at the town's Kirkgate Centre, features a host of local talent and will offer an exclusive taster of what’s in store at the next Cockermouth Live! festival this summer.
Members decided to rerecord Cover of Rolling Stone by Dr Hook as a tribute to the Times & Star and say it will become the group's trademark song.
